Lapp’s Farm Market

Lapp’s Farm Market is a charming Lancaster destination where local flavor and family tradition come together. Located just a short drive from the heart of Amish country, this family-owned market has become a staple for fresh produce, homemade baked goods, and handcrafted products. Whether you’re a local looking for fresh eggs and vegetables or a visitor eager to experience Lancaster’s farming roots, Lapp’s Farm Market offers an inviting and authentic atmosphere. The market is known for its warm hospitality, reasonable prices, and wide variety of seasonal specialties. It’s not just a place to shop—it’s a place to connect with the community, enjoy a peaceful country setting, and take home something special.

Seasonal Highlights

Spring:
Celebrate the season with freshly picked strawberries, early greens, and vibrant flower baskets perfect for gardens or porches.

Summer:
Enjoy peak produce like sweet corn, tomatoes, melons, and peaches. Handmade lemonade and ice cream often pop up at the stand.

Fall:
Pumpkins, gourds, and mums take over the market, along with homemade apple pies and local cider. A favorite time for seasonal displays.

Winter:
Look for hearty root vegetables, winter squash, and festive holiday baked goods. The cozy atmosphere and holiday décor create a welcoming winter retreat.

FAQs

Are pets allowed?
Pets are not allowed inside the market but are welcome on the grounds if leashed.

Do they accept credit cards?
Yes, most vendors accept credit and debit cards, though some prefer cash.

Are there bathrooms on-site?
Yes, clean restrooms are available for customers.

Is the market open during winter?
Yes, Lapp’s Farm Market operates year-round with seasonal selections.

Can I find organic and locally grown produce at the market?
Absolutely. Many fruits and vegetables are organic and locally sourced.
